The Municipality of Pielavesi maintains Penkkilenkki as one of three signed nature and outdoor routes in the church village, together with Urkin polku and Rantapolku. The same page describes the concept: thirty-five backrest benches roughly 250 metres apart, placed so the next bench stays in sight, plus four map boa...
Follow the numbered benches and map boards; the Municipality of Pielavesi describes the circuit from the heritage museum and Pielakoti area through the village. You can join shorter segments anywhere along the shore ring.

Allow roughly 1.5–2.5 hours at an easy walking pace with bench stops, history QR listens, and optional exercises—longer if you use swimming or café breaks.

Mixed paved lakeside path and village streets with short gravel links; bench landings are kept open for assisted mobility.
